body {
	font-family:Geneva, Arial, Helvetica, sans-serif;

	background-color: 2e5876#;
	margin-top: 5px;
	font-size: 13px;
	color:#000000;
	background-color: #820a00;
}


.tablenavigation {color:#000000;}
.tablenavigation:visited {color:#820a00;
					background-color:transparent;}
.topheader {
	font-size: 14px;
	font-weight: bold;
	color: #FFCC00;
	background-color: #000000;
	line-height: 18px;
	font-style: italic;
	padding-right: 5px;
	text-align: right;
}
.outerborder {
	border: medium solid #000000;
}


.gargano {
	font-size: 16px;
	color:#820a00;
	font-weight: 900;
	line-height: 30px;
	background-color:#FFFFFF;	
}
.smallblackwhite {font-weight: bold; font-size: 12px; color: #000000; 
			background-color:#FFFFFF;}
.largeblackwhite {
	font-size: 16px;
	color:#000000;
	font-weight: bold;
	background-color:#FFFFFF
;
	line-height: 28px;
	padding-right: 10px;
}
.navigation {
	background-color:#000000;
	color:#e3550a;
	font-weight:bold;
	text-decoration:none;
	font-size: 13px;
}
.smallyellowblack {
	font-size: 11px;
	color: #ffcb33;
	background-color:#000000;
}
.maintext {
	font-size: 12px;
	color: #000000;
	background-color: #FFFFFF;
	padding-right: 10px;
	padding-left: 0px;
	font-weight: bold;
}

.navigation:visited {
	font-weight: bold;
	color: #ac6a23;
	text-decoration: none;
	background-color:#000000;
}
.activepage {
	font-size: 13px;
	font-weight: bold;
	color: #ffcb33;
	background-color: #000000;
}
.activepagesmall {
	color: #ffcb33;
	background-color: #000000;
}


.bodyheader {
	background-color:#FFFFFF;
	color:#820a00;
	font-size: 18px;
}
td {
	padding-left: 10px;
	padding-right: 5px;
}





.navigation:hover {
	background-color:#000000;
	color:#ffcb33;
	font-weight:bold;
	font-size: 14px;
}
.navigationsmall {

	background-color:#FFFFFF;
	color:#820a00;
	font-weight:bold;
	text-decoration:none;
	font-size: 11px;
	text-align: left;
}
.navigationsmall:visited {
	font-weight: bold;
	color: #a35517;
	text-decoration: none;
	background-color:#FFFFFF;
}
.navigationsmall:hover {
	background-color:#000000;
	color:#ffcb33;
	font-weight:bold;
	text-decoration:none;
}
.nopadding {
	padding-left:0px;
	padding-right: 0px;
}
.trainingheaders {
	font-size: 14px;
	font-weight: bold;
	color: #000000;
	background-color: #FFFFFF;
}
.navigationlarge {

	background-color:#FFFFFF;
	color:#820a00;
	font-weight:bold;
	font-size: 16px;
	text-align: left;
}
.navigationlarge:visited {
	font-weight: bold;
	color: #a35517;
	background-color:#FFFFFF;
}
.navigationlarge:hover {
	background-color:#FFFFFF;
	color:#000000;
	font-weight:bold;
	text-decoration:none;
}
